Embry-Riddle Aeronautical University (ERAU) seeks a dynamic, student-centered, and forward-thinking Assistant Coach (Women's Lacrosse) to provide visionary leadership.
The assistant women's lacrosse coach supports the head coach and is responsible for a variety of coaching, teaching, and recruiting tasks, along with practice and game-day related functions as assigned by the head coach.
Primary Job Functions, Duties, or Accountabilities:
  • Provide instruction to women's lacrosse student-athletes on the fundamentals and strategies of women's lacrosse.
  • Assist in recruiting and retaining highly skilled student-athletes for the women's lacrosse team.
  • Actively support and promote the NCAA's Life in the Balance strategic platform, embracing the six ideals of learning, balance, resourcefulness, sportsmanship, passion, and service.
  • Assist in monitoring the academic progress of all women's lacrosse team members.
  • Maintain and manage team equipment.
  • Assist in securing donations and sponsorships to support the women's lacrosse program .
  • Assist with arranging for lodging and meals for team trips.
  • Assume duties of the head coach in their absence.
  • Knowledge, understanding, and ability to instruct sport-specific skills, techniques, and strategies.
  • Ability to lead, motivate, develop, recruit, and coach student-athletes at the collegiate level.
  • Understanding of the NCAA bylaws, rules, and regulations.
